Abstract

A lighting device includes a light source, a light guideprovided adjacent to the light sourceand including a light source light incident surfaceon which light emitted by the light sourceenters and a planar light emission surfacefrom which planar light is emitted, and an optical sheetincluding a planar light incident surfaceon which the planar light enters, and configured to change a traveling direction of the planar light because a light emission side of the optical sheethas a shape in which plural columnar prismsextending in parallel to the light source light incident surfaceare arranged side by side. In each of the prisms, a distal surface has at least different two kinds of inclination angles.
